WaterBear Sheffield is based in the Gatecrasher Building on Eyre Lane and Arundel Street in the city centre, on the site of the iconic Gatecrasher nightclub. Our facilities provide everything you need to develop as a modern musician: Mac suites, a professional recording studio, rehearsal and performance spaces, and dedicated teaching rooms. As a college run by professional musicians, we know what gear you need: vintage and modern amps, analogue and digital equipment, giving you the best of both worlds.

Beyond our on-site facilities, you’ll also access professional recording studios across Sheffield including Spring Tank Studios, Studio Tecna (Self Esteem, Reverend and the Makers), Hybrid3 with custom-built equipment, and also MU Studios for our MA courses. You’ll also perform at working music venues across the city, including Corporation, a live music venue for pre-production and live performance workshops. Plans are also underway to open our own music venue in Sheffield.

Throughout your studies, you’ll receive free bookable access to our internal and our Sheffield partner recording and rehearsal facilities. Whether developing your own material or collaborating with other musicians, our facilities support every stage of the creative process, from songwriting and pre-production to tracking, mixing, and live performance.

Facilities for producers

On-Site at WaterBear Gatecrasher HQ:

  • Sheffield Recording Studio (Eyre Lane): SSL 8-channel mixer, Warm Audio outboard, Universal Audio Apollo X8P
  • Mac Suite 1 & 2 (Eyre Lane): 14 iMacs and 16 MacBook Pros with Logic Pro, Ableton Live, Pro Tools
  • Production teaching delivered at HQ

Partner Studios (Free Bookable Access):

  • Studio Tecna & Hybrid3: Professional mixing desks bookable for production work, Pro Tools/Logic Pro/Ableton Live, mixing and mastering services

Partner Venues and Recording Studios

Through our city-wide partnerships, you’ll have free bookable access to recording and rehearsal facilities, plus extensive opportunities to perform live in working music venues across Sheffield. These partnerships give you access to world-class professional equipment and expertise, alongside local networking and work experience opportunities.

MU Studios

MU Studios, located in Nether Edge, is Sheffield’s premier recording, mixing, and mastering studio, providing bands, artists, and songwriters with the perfect environment to create their best-sounding music. Many renowned bands and artists from Sheffield and beyond have recorded there, including Jarvis Cocker and Richard Hawley.
